Vibration-proof fast splicing platform made of flexible molecular materials
The invention provides a vibration-proof fast splicing platform made of flexible molecular materials. The vibration-proof fast splicing platform is formed by splicing four identical fan-shaped splicing plates and a plurality of annular splicing plates, in addition, the fan-shaped splicing plates and the annular splicing plates are made of the flexible molecular materials, and steel plates cover the top surface, the bottom surface and the side walls of the fan-shaped splicing plates and the annular splicing plates. The vibration-proof fast splicing platform has the strong advantages that the quality is high, and portability, repeated use and random assembly are realized. In addition, the fan-shaped splicing plates and the annular splicing plates are made of the flexible molecular materials, in addition, the steel plates cover the top surfaces, the bottom surfaces and the side walls of the fan-shaped splicing plate and the annular splicing plates, and the vibration-proof fast splicing platform has the advantages that the weight is light, the service life is long, and the like.
